Output ed7a90610d7a308c180b3409f58a72691b0e19b67a72fbf220f42d39087d51e5:2

value
1424954
script pubkey
OP_0 OP_PUSHBYTES_20 ec176084dd0c72cdc47e0ae63249b9e02e047a2b
address
bc1qastkppxap3evm3r7ptnryjdeuqhqg73txrurpz
transaction
ed7a90610d7a308c180b3409f58a72691b0e19b67a72fbf220f42d39087d51e5
spent
true